BioNames
Timeline
Dashboard
API
Name
Bibliography
Data
About
...
Mastrus rufulus gallicator (Aubert, 1960)
Source
Rank
subspecies
species:6250423
Classification
Mastrus rufulus (Thomson, 1884)
Mastrus rufulus gallicator (Aubert, 1960)